Understanding the Mechanics of Chicken Road

At its heart, ‘chicken road’ is built around a linear progression system. Players assume the role of guiding a chicken along a path comprised of various segments. Each segment represents a potential multiplier, increasing the player’s winnings if the chicken successfully navigates it. However, lurking within these segments are traps and hazards that can instantly end the game, forfeiting any accumulated profits. The decision point, the key strategic element of the game, arises at each segment. Do you continue, risking the potential for a larger reward, or do you cash out, securing your earnings and avoiding the risk of losing it all? The beauty of the game lies in this constant calculation, the internal debate between greed and prudence.

The strategic depth stems from the psychological element of risk assessment. Players must not only evaluate the potential rewards but also their own risk tolerance. Early on, with relatively small winnings, the incentive to continue is often strong. However, as the accumulated profits grow, the stakes increase, and the pressure mounts. This creates a compelling dynamic, forcing players to confront their own anxieties and make calculated decisions. Understanding the odds associated with each segment is also crucial, but even then, the element of chance can introduce unpredictable outcomes, adding to the thrill and excitement.

The Role of Cognitive Biases

Several cognitive biases influence players’ decision-making processes in ‘chicken road’. The gambler’s fallacy, for example, leads players to believe that after a series of unsuccessful attempts, a win is more likely to occur, encouraging them to continue playing despite the odds. The house money effect encourages players to take greater risks when playing with winnings, feeling less averse to losing money that isn’t “theirs”. Understanding these biases is crucial for players seeking to make rational decisions and avoid falling prey to psychological manipulation. Recognizing how these biases impact judgment can lead to a more informed and strategic approach to the game.

Comparing Chicken Road to Other Risk-Reward Games

‘Chicken road’ shares similarities with many other popular risk-reward games, such as card games like blackjack and poker, and certain types of slot machines. In blackjack, players must strategically decide whether to ‘hit’ or ‘stand’, balancing the potential for a higher hand against the risk of ‘busting’. In poker, players must assess the strength of their hand and decide whether to bet, call, or fold, weighing the potential rewards against the risk of losing their investment. These games, like ‘chicken road’, rely on a combination of skill, strategy, and chance to determine the outcome.

However, ‘chicken road’ distinguishes itself through its simplicity and immediate gratification. Unlike poker or blackjack, which require a more substantial learning curve, ‘chicken road’ is instantly accessible to anyone. The rules are straightforward, and the gameplay is fast-paced and engaging. This accessibility makes it appealing to a wider audience, particularly those seeking a quick and casual form of entertainment. Furthermore, the visually appealing graphics and the charming chicken theme add to the overall enjoyment of the game. This combination of simplicity, accessibility, and visual appeal has contributed to its growing popularity.
